Analysis

The most recent figure for medical doctors in Guinea-Bissau is 548, measured in 2024.

That represents a change of up 77.9% on the previous year and up 54.8% over ten years.

Over the whole period, medical doctors in Guinea-Bissau peaked at 578 in 2018 and was at its lowest, 78, in 2008.

Guinea-Bissau ranks 157th of 187 countries on this measure, in the bottom quarter.

The series is highly variable year to year, so single readings are best treated with caution.
